Late Friday night, Travis Barker (formerly known from Blink-182) and celebrity DJ “DJ AM” were taking off from Columbia, South Carolina’s airport when their plane immediately crashed upon take off. Six were on the plane and four immediately perished, including Barker’s personal assistant, when the plane crashed into a street. The only two survivors are Barker and DJ AM (Adam Goldstein) and both are in critical condition with severe burns.

A New Earth: Oprah’s New Book Choice

Wednesday, January 30th, 2008

Regardless of what you think of Oprah (personally, she’s one of my heroes), you can not deny her influence she has in the world especially when it comes to choosing books. I, myself, am not necessarily an avid book reader. My Mom is but I have never been. I will say, though, after watching Oprah’s show today, I can NOT wait to get a hold of her new book club’s choice — A New Earth: Awakening to Your Life’s Purpose (click on the link to read more about it)

Why did I decide to write about this? Simple. Oprah announced today on her show that she will be holding her first ever web class regarding this book. She and author Eckhart Tolle will be conducting this web class for ten weeks (every Monday night) starting Monday, March 3rd, 2008.

The best part? Anyone around the world can reserve a “seat” in her interactive classroom. So sign up now.
